Summary: | A non-transitory computer-readable medium includes instructions that, when provided to and executed by a processor, cause the processor to receive a first placement of domain instances of an integrated circuit layout provided as a tile having a group of multiple power domain modules. The first placement of domain instances is scanned to identify instances associated with a preselected power specification. A heuristic is applied to the first placement of domain instances to form an observation area. the heuristic demarcates select instances to form the observation area. Each instance associated with the preselected power specification is identified in the observation area. A contiguous region of instances is formed from the select instances in the observation area. The first placement of domain instances in the integrated circuit layout is modified to provided revised placement for instances associated with the contiguous region of instances. |
